Companies Home Search Profile

AWS Glue : A Comprehensive Guide for Beginners

Focused View

Lal Verma

4:40:47

66 View
  • 1. Welcome Note.mp4
    02:32
  • 2. AWS Glue - 101.mp4
    03:59
  • 3. Course Overview.mp4
    02:15
  • 1. Core Components Overview.mp4
    00:28
  • 2. AWS Glue Data Catalog.mp4
    01:44
  • 3. Data Catalog Database.mp4
    01:42
  • 4. Data Catalog Tables.mp4
    01:45
  • 5. Crawler.mp4
    02:41
  • 6. AWS Glue Job.mp4
    02:00
  • 1. Getting Started Overview.mp4
    00:33
  • 2. [Optional] Setting Up AWS Account.mp4
    03:31
  • 3. Setting Up IAM User and Role.mp4
    05:17
  • 4. Setting Up Source Data.mp4
    06:01
  • 5. Creating ETL Job in AWS Glue.mp4
    06:09
  • 6. Running and Validating ETL Job.mp4
    02:59
  • 1. Data Catalog and Preparation Overview.mp4
    00:35
  • 2. Crawler Supported Data Stores.mp4
    04:09
  • 3. Glue Connection.mp4
    04:34
  • 4. Demo AWS Glue Connection.mp4
    06:31
  • 5. Crawler Built-In Classifiers.mp4
    03:08
  • 6. Crawler Custom Classifiers.html
  • 7. Demo Creating Custom Classifiers.mp4
    08:23
  • 8. Table Partitions Overview.mp4
    02:39
  • 9. Demo Table Partitions.mp4
    06:13
  • 10. Table Partitions Index Overview.html
  • 11. Demo Table Partition Index.mp4
    05:11
  • 12. Column Statistics Overview.mp4
    02:46
  • 13. Demo Column Statistics.mp4
    04:15
  • 14. References.html
  • 1. Building ETL Jobs Overview.mp4
    00:32
  • 2. Visual ETL Overview.mp4
    01:24
  • 3. Visual ETL Features.mp4
    06:17
  • 4. [Optional] Apache Spark 101.mp4
    02:51
  • 5. Built In and Custom Transforms Quick Note.html
  • 6. Built-in Transforms.mp4
    05:24
  • 7. Build-In Transforms - Notes.html
  • 8. Demo Custom Transform.mp4
    07:48
  • 1. AWS Glue Script Editor.mp4
    02:00
  • 2. Apache Spark API Core Modules.html
  • 3. AWS Glue API Core Modules.html
  • 4. Demo Build ETL with Script Editor - Spark.mp4
    06:17
  • 5. Script Editor Notes & References.html
  • 1. Python Shell Job in AWS Glue.mp4
    03:06
  • 2. Pandas - 101.html
  • 3. AWS SDK for PythonBoto3 - 101.html
  • 4. Demo Building ETL Job for Python Shell.mp4
    04:53
  • 5. Python Shell Notes and References.html
  • 1. Interactive Sessions Section Overview.mp4
    01:27
  • 2. [optional] Jupyter Notebooks - 101.mp4
    03:37
  • 3. Interactive Sessions Overview.mp4
    03:08
  • 4. Demo Building ETL Jobs with Notebook.mp4
    09:20
  • 5. Demo Building Jobs with Jupyter Notebook.mp4
    06:34
  • 6. Magic Commands.mp4
    02:23
  • 7. Interactive Sessions Notes & References.html
  • 1. AWS Glue Streaming Overview.mp4
    05:34
  • 2. Demo AWS Glue Streaming - Part 1.mp4
    05:01
  • 3. Demo AWS Glue Streaming - Part 2.mp4
    06:18
  • 4. AWS Glue Streaming Additional Notes.html
  • 1. What is Ray An Overview.mp4
    05:37
  • 2. Enabling Ray with AWS Glue.mp4
    02:21
  • 3. Demo Sample Ray Job using Script Editor.mp4
    04:25
  • 4. Demo Sample Ray Job using Glue Studio Notebooks.mp4
    03:45
  • 5. ETL Jobs with Ray Notes and References.html
  • 1. Configuration Overview.mp4
    00:36
  • 2. Glue Versions.mp4
    02:48
  • 3. Configuring Properties for Spark Jobs.mp4
    06:37
  • 4. Configuring Properties for Python Shell Jobs.mp4
    02:13
  • 5. Configuring Properties for Ray Jobs.mp4
    01:37
  • 6. AWS CLI - Notes.html
  • 7. [Optional] AWS CLI - 101.mp4
    03:48
  • 8. AWS CLI and AWS Glue.mp4
    04:27
  • 9. Job Parameters.mp4
    05:19
  • 10. Reference Job Configuration.html
  • 1. Job Monitoring.mp4
    07:07
  • 2. Standard Metrics - AWS Glue Spark Jobs.mp4
    07:05
  • 3. Observability Metrics - AWS Glue Spark Jobs.mp4
    04:00
  • 4. Spark UI - AWS Glue Spark Jobs.mp4
    04:58
  • 5. Logging - AWS Glue Spark Jobs.mp4
    05:33
  • 6. Job Run Insights AWS Glue Spark Jobs.mp4
    04:46
  • 7. Monitoring & Logging Additional Notes & References.html
  • 1. Tools Overview.mp4
    00:17
  • 2. AWS CLI and AWS Glue.html
  • 3. [Optional] AWS CloudFormation - 101.mp4
    06:42
  • 4. AWS CloudFormation and AWS Glue.mp4
    05:44
  • 5. AWS SDK and AWS Glue.mp4
    05:07
  • 6. Tools Additional Notes & References.html
  • 1. Pricing.mp4
    04:04
  • 2. Conclusion.mp4
    02:52
  • 3. Conclusion References.html
  • 1. Built-In Transforms Part 2.mp4
    03:05
  • Description


    Simplifying Data Discovery, Preparation and Loading with AWS Glue

    What You'll Learn?


    • Data Catalog and Preparation - Tables, Crawlers, Classifiers, Partitions, Column Statistics
    • Supported Data Stores, Glue Connections
    • Building ETL Jobs - Visual Editor
    • Building ETL Jobs - Script Editor
    • Build ETL Job - Notebooks
    • Build ETL Job - Python Shell
    • Build ETL Job - Interactive Sessions
    • Building ETL Jobs with Streaming Data
    • Jobs Configuration
    • Monitoring and Troubleshooting Jobs
    • Best Practices

    Who is this for?


  • Data Engineers, Data Scientists or Data Analysts looking forward to understand AWS Glue
  • What You Need to Know?


  • Basic Awareness on AWS
  • Basic Awareness on Apache Spark
  • Programming experience in Python
  • Basic Awareness on Jupyter Notebooks
  • Basic Awareness on Ray
  • Basic Awareness on Pandas
  • More details


    Description

    Welcome to the AWS Glue Course: Simplifying ETL and Data Preparation

    Unlock the power of AWS Glue and transform the way you handle data integration and preparation. Whether you're a data engineer, data scientist, developer, or data analyst, this comprehensive course is designed to equip you with the knowledge and skills to efficiently use AWS Glue for your data processing needs.


    Course Overview

    AWS Glue is a fully managed ETL (Extract, Transform, Load) service that makes it easy to prepare and load your data for analytics. In this course, we'll explore AWS Glue from the ground up, starting with the basics and gradually moving on to more advanced topics and practical applications. Here's what you can expect:


    1. Introduction

    2. AWS Glue Basics - Core Components, How it Works?

    3. Getting Started

    4. Data Discovery

    5. Building Jobs with Visual ETL

    6. Building Jobs with Script Editor

    7. Building Jobs with Interactive Sessions

    8. Building Jobs with Python Shell

    9. Building Jobs using Ray Framework

    10. Glue Streaming - Building Streaming Jobs

    11. Jobs Configuration

    12. Monitoring

    13. Tools

    14. Advanced Concepts

    15. Conclusion

    Who Should Take This Course?

    This course is ideal for anyone who wants to leverage AWS Glue for data integration and preparation tasks. No prior experience with AWS Glue is required, but a basic understanding of AWS services and data processing concepts will be helpful.

    What You Will Learn?

    By the end of this course, you will be able to:

    • Understand the core functionalities and benefits of AWS Glue.

    • Efficiently catalog and manage your data using AWS Glue Crawlers and the Data Catalog.

    • Create and manage ETL jobs to transform and move your data.

    • Utilize advanced features for more sophisticated data preparation tasks.

    • Integrate AWS Glue with other AWS services to build comprehensive data solutions.

    • Apply best practices to optimize performance, manage costs, and ensure data security.


    Enroll Now

    Hello, I'm Lal Verma, your instructor for this course. With extensive experience in data engineering and cloud computing, I'm excited to guide you through the world of AWS Glue. Together, we'll unlock the full potential of AWS Glue and transform the way you handle data integration and preparation.

    Join us in this journey to master AWS Glue and revolutionize your data workflows. Enroll now and start transforming your data integration and preparation processes with AWS Glue!

    Who this course is for:

    • Data Engineers, Data Scientists or Data Analysts looking forward to understand AWS Glue

    User Reviews
    Rating
    0
    0
    0
    0
    0
    average 0
    Total votes0
    Focused display
    Category
    I am a solution architect having around 20+ years of experience in the design and development of enterprise softwares.  My expertise includes  Cloud Technologies (AWS, Google Cloud),  Data Analytics, Microservices, NoSql databases, Serverless Computing, Middleware, UI Technologies (Angular, Reactjs), and many other legacy technologies and frameworks.  Some of the major enterprises I served include Schlumberger, Sears Holdings, FedEx, Daimler Trucks North America, Cigna Healthcare, and StateStreet.
    Students take courses primarily to improve job-related skills.Some courses generate credit toward technical certification. Udemy has made a special effort to attract corporate trainers seeking to create coursework for employees of their company.
    • language english
    • Training sessions 70
    • duration 4:40:47
    • Release Date 2024/07/26